COSCO has announced that it has won orders for three Kamsarmax bulkers for European and Chinese owners. All vessels will be built at the company’s Dalian Shipyard in northeast China. Illegal fishing is pushing fishermen out of work, according to Hadijatou Jallow from the Guinea Current Large Marine Ecosystem Project – an organisation assisting countries adjacent to the Guinea Current Ecosystem to achieve environmental sustainability.
